Title: Pharmaceutical Machines: Enhancing Efficiency and Quality in Drug Manufacturing
Pharmaceutical machines play a crucial role in the manufacturing process of drugs by improving efficiency and ensuring quality. Two important types of machines used in pharmaceutical production are table press machines and capsule filling machines.
Table press machines, such as the TDP and THDP models, are used to compress powdered ingredients into tablets of uniform size and shape. These machines operate by applying pressure to the powder within a die cavity, forming the tablet shape. The TDP machine, for example, is known for its compact design and easy operation, making it a popular choice for small to medium-scale pharmaceutical companies. On the other hand, the THDP machine offers higher production capacities and more advanced features, making it suitable for larger manufacturing facilities.
Capsule filling machines are another essential part of the pharmaceutical production process. These machines automate the process of filling empty capsules with the desired dosage of powdered or granulated medication. By using capsule filling machines, manufacturers can ensure accurate dosing and maintain consistency in product quality. These machines are available in different versions, ranging from semi-automatic to fully automatic, depending on the scale of production and specific requirements of the pharmaceutical company.
In addition to improving efficiency, pharmaceutical machines also play a critical role in ensuring the quality and safety of the drugs being manufactured. By automating certain processes, these machines help minimize human errors and contamination risks, enhancing the overall quality control measures in pharmaceutical production. Furthermore, the use of advanced technologies in these machines allows for precise control over various parameters like compression force, speed, and dosage, leading to more consistent and accurate results.
